The Key to Selling Luxury (Because It Won't Sell Itself)
In this episode, Kim breaks down why high-end properties don't sell themselves and what actually moves them in today's market. If you've ever wondered why a beautiful home can stall, why price reductions hurt momentum, or why "just testing the market" backfires, this conversation pulls back the curtain. You'll learn the three biggest reasons luxury listings linger — aspirational pricing, misaligned exposure, and presentation that doesn't match the ask — and what to do instead. Kim walks through how to price with both data and psychology, why the first 7–10 days on market are critical, how to curate a home so it feels effortless (not cluttered), and why luxury marketing is about storytelling plus strategic distribution. Takeaways: Luxury pricing must create momentum, starting too high trains the market to ignore you. Exposure only works if it reaches the right buyers and the right agents, not just more views. Presentation has to match the price point from day one. The first 7–10 days on market are critical; preparation and strategy determine whether you build excitement. Luxury buyers aren't just buying a house, they're buying ease, lifestyle, craftsmanship, and confidence in the process.
